原始題目如下!
Consider a sample of a hydrocarbon(a compound consisting of only carbon and hydrogen) at 0.959 atm and 298 K.
Upon combusting the entire sample in oxygen,
you collect a mixture of gaseous carbon dioxide and water vapor at 1.51 atm and 375K.
This mixture has a density of 1.391 g/L and occupies a volume four times as large as that of the pure hydrocarbon.
Determine the molecular formula of the hydrocarbon.
